Product Overview
The SURIEEN AC Charge Hose with Gauge is a purpose‑engineered kit designed for automotive air‑conditioning maintenance. At its core is a 13 mm diameter hose constructed from a durable brass core encased in high‑grade rubber, delivering a balance of rigidity and flexibility that resists kinking while tolerating the pressures of refrigerant flow up to 250 psi. The hose terminates in a 0.5‑inch UNF thread on one end, compatible with standard 1/2″ ACME valve fittings, and a 1/4″ SAE male thread on the opposite side, allowing seamless integration with most vehicle service ports.
Integrated into the assembly is a compact, analog pressure gauge calibrated from 0 to 250 psi, providing real‑time feedback during charge operations. The gauge is mounted on a sturdy aluminum‑brass housing that protects the dial from impact and vibration. Adjacent to the gauge, a built‑in safety valve automatically vents excess pressure, safeguarding both the technician and the vehicle’s compressor.
Complementing the hose and gauge is a precision‑machined R134A piercing can tap with a 1/2″ thread. This tap pierces the high‑side service port without the need for additional tools, delivering a quick, leak‑free connection. On the opposite side, a low‑side adjustable quick coupler features a T‑type knob with an internal pin that locks securely when pressure is applied, then releases effortlessly when the knob is turned. This design eliminates the risk of accidental venting and ensures a tight seal throughout the charging process.
The kit is packaged in a compact 6.69 × 6.02 × 1.34 inch box, weighing just 3.52 ounces, making it ideal for both workshop shelves and mobile service vans. The bright blue color coding of the hose and gauge enhances visibility in cluttered environments, reducing the chance of mis‑identification during busy service intervals.
Usage
This kit is engineered for a wide range of usage scenarios, from routine maintenance on passenger cars to more demanding applications on light trucks and SUVs. When a vehicle’s AC system loses refrigerant due to a leak or simply requires a top‑up, the technician can connect the 1/2″ piercing tap directly to the high‑side service port, then attach the low‑side quick coupler to the corresponding low‑side port. The built‑in gauge displays the system pressure, allowing the operator to monitor the charge level and stop the flow precisely when the target pressure is reached.
Because the hose is constructed from brass and rubber, it tolerates temperature fluctuations from cold winter mornings to hot summer afternoons without degrading. The flexible rubber sheath also enables the hose to be routed around engine components, under the dashboard, or through tight engine bays without excessive bending. This flexibility is especially valuable for DIY enthusiasts who may be working in cramped garage spaces or on‑site at remote locations.
The kit is also suitable for home‑based air‑conditioning units that use R134A, R12, or R22 refrigerants. By swapping the appropriate can tap, the same hose and gauge can service residential split‑systems, providing a cost‑effective solution for seasonal recharging tasks. The safety valve and quick‑release coupler together ensure that even non‑professional users can operate the kit with confidence, minimizing the risk of over‑pressurization or accidental discharge.

FAQ
What refrigerants are compatible with this kit?
The kit is primarily designed for R134A, which is the standard refrigerant in most modern automotive AC systems. However, the can tap can also be used with R12 or R22 if the appropriate adapter is installed, making the kit versatile for both vehicle and residential applications.
How do I know when the refrigerant charge is complete?
Watch the built‑in gauge as you add refrigerant. The gauge is calibrated to display pressure in psi. When the reading reaches the manufacturer‑specified target pressure for your vehicle (typically found in the service manual), the low‑side quick coupler will automatically shut off, preventing over‑charging.
Can I use this kit on a motorcycle or small engine?
Yes, the hose’s 13 mm diameter and flexible construction make it suitable for smaller engines, provided the service ports match the 1/2″ and 1/4″ thread sizes. Always verify the pressure specifications of the smaller system before charging.
What safety measures are built into the kit?
The kit includes a pressure relief valve that vents excess pressure, a low‑side quick coupler that auto‑shuts off at the set pressure, and a sturdy gauge housing that protects the dial from impact. These features work together to keep the user safe and the system protected.
How do I maintain the hose and gauge for long‑term use?
After each use, purge any remaining refrigerant from the hose, wipe the exterior with a clean cloth, and store the kit in a cool, dry place. Periodically inspect the gauge for accuracy using a calibrated reference gauge, and replace the hose if you notice any cracks or wear in the rubber sheath.
